
Vietnam cracks down on online piracy and counterfeit goods amid U.S. tariff threat
🤖AI Özeti
Vietnam is facing renewed pressure from the United States regarding its handling of intellectual property violations, particularly in online piracy and counterfeit goods. The U.S. has indicated the possibility of imposing new tariffs due to what it describes as Hanoi's 'persistent failure' to address these issues. This situation highlights the ongoing tensions between the two countries over trade practices and enforcement of intellectual property rights.

Vietnam has been a focal point for discussions around trade and intellectual property rights, particularly as it seeks to enhance its economic standing in the global market. The U.S. has long advocated for stronger enforcement of intellectual property laws to protect American businesses and innovations, making this a critical issue in U.S.-Vietnam relations.
